A Comprehensive Guide to Buying Prednisone Online
Prednisone is a powerful corticosteroid medication used to treat a wide variety of inflammatory and autoimmune conditions, such as asthma, rheumatoid arthritis, lupus, and severe allergic reactions. It works by mimicking the effects of hormones your body naturally produces in your adrenal glands, reducing inflammation and suppressing an overactive immune system. Available Strengths & Forms
Prednisone is primarily available in oral tablet form. It comes in a range of strengths to allow for precise dosing, which is often crucial for tapering schedules. The most common strengths include:
- 1 mg (often used for low-dose maintenance or tapering)
- 2.5 mg
- 5 mg (one of the most frequently prescribed strengths)
- 10 mg
- 20 mg (used for more severe inflammatory flares)
- 50 mg (less common, for specific high-dose protocols)
Prednisone is typically supplied as immediate-release tablets. It is important to note that Prednisolone is a closely related drug often used interchangeably but may be preferred in patients with liver conditions.

Storage
Proper storage is vital to maintain the efficacy and safety of prednisone.
- Temperature: Store at room temperature (68°F to 77°F or 20°C to 25°C). Avoid freezing, excessive heat, and moisture (do not store in a bathroom).
- Container: Keep the tablets in their original, light-resistant container with the lid tightly closed.
- Location: Keep out of reach of children and pets.
- Disposal: Do not flush unused medication. Follow local guidelines for medication take-back programs or mix with an undesirable substance (like used coffee grounds) in a sealed bag before disposing in the trash.
Generic vs Brand
| Aspect | Generic Prednisone | Brand Name (e.g., Deltasone) |
|---|---|---|
| Active Ingredient | Identical. Contains prednisone. | Identical. Contains prednisone. |
| Efficacy & Safety | Required by law (FDA, etc.) to be bioequivalent, meaning it works the same way in the body. | Clinically proven efficacy and safety profile. |
| Cost | Significantly lower. Often 80-95% less expensive than the brand name. | Substantially higher due to patent and marketing costs. |
| Inactive Ingredients | May differ (fillers, binders, dyes). This rarely affects performance but could matter for those with specific allergies. | Use proprietary inactive ingredients. |
| Appearance | Color and shape may differ from the brand-name version. | Has a distinct, consistent appearance. |
For the vast majority of patients, generic prednisone is the recommended and cost-effective choice, offering the same therapeutic benefits;

A: Dosing is highly individualized. Often, a high initial dose is prescribed, which is then gradually tapered ("prednisone taper") to allow the adrenal glands to resume natural cortisol production and to minimize withdrawal symptoms. Never stop taking prednisone abruptly. - Q: What are the main side effects I should watch for?
A: Common side effects include increased appetite, insomnia, mood changes, and fluid retention. More serious potential effects include high blood pressure, elevated blood sugar, increased infection risk, and bone loss. Report any concerning symptoms to your doctor immediately. - Q: Can I drink alcohol while taking prednisone?
A: It is generally not recommended. Both prednisone and alcohol can irritate the stomach lining and may increase the risk of gastrointestinal upset or bleeding. Alcohol can also worsen some side effects like dizziness.
